One of the significant applications of Thioanisole is its role as an efficient starter for the acid-catalyzed cleavage of certain protecting groups, such as N-Z, O-benzyl, and O-methyl groups. This capability is invaluable in multi-step organic synthesis, allowing chemists to selectively remove protective layers without affecting other sensitive parts of the molecule.
